getLocation 获取自己的位置信息 拿到 经纬度
chooseLocation重新获取位置经纬度
必须在app.json中申请调用权限 地址逆解析
"requiredPrivateInfos": [ "getLocation", "chooseLocation" ],
腾讯位置服务 下载QQmap文件
//导入刚刚下载的QQmap文件
import QQMapWX from '../libs/qqmap-wx-jssdk.min'
// 填写自已在腾讯地图创建应用的 key
export default new QQMapWX({
key: 'R3PBZ-EIALV-HYDP3-U7LWC-NNNJS-MAFN4Q7',
})
拿到真实地址信息 qqMap.reverseGeocoder({ location: [latitude, longitude].join(','), success: ( res) => { // 更新数据,重新渲染 this.setData({ res.result address }) }, })
qqMap.search({ // 搜索关键字(查询周边的小区) keyword: '住宅小区', // 指定经纬度 location: [latitude, longitude].join(